Our alarm system uses an analogue line. We are proposing to use this for ADSL. Has anyone done this? Are there any issues I should know about?

I was told by a Cold Calling ADT Alarm Salesman that their system wouldn't work on our ADSL enabled line, but I can't see why it wouldn't so long as you had a filter on the line that the alarm is connected to the same as your other sockets. It is, after all, just a phone dialler.

I had many discussions with ADT about this at my previous address. After explaining what the ADSL filter does and they should install one between the alarm box and the main phone socket, they would not and insisted that it would not interfere with the ADSL. Of course when it dialed up, the ADSL connection was lost.
My system only dialed out when the alarm went off. Therefore I guess if my ADSL connection disappeared only at that time, I could put up with it.
